James Allen Parker
Baldwyn - James Allen Parker, age 56, passed away on Monday, August 11, 2025, at North Mississippi Medical Center. Born on August 9, 1969, to Jewel Elizabeth Stacks Parker and Walker Mace Parker Jr., James—known to most simply as “Parker”—lived a life marked by deep love, laughter, and an unwavering devotion to faith and family.
Parker was a man who never met a stranger. His heart was as big as his sense of humor, and he made fast friends everywhere he went. Known for his playful spirit and quick wit, he delighted in joking around with everyone—often turning everyday moments into cherished memories. To be teased by Parker was to be loved by him.
His priorities were clear and simple: God, family, and the Pittsburgh Steelers—always in that order. A true family man, Parker's greatest joys came from spending quality time with his children and grandchildren. Whether he was singing songs to his kids, casting a line on a quiet afternoon fishing with his grandsons, or tossing a football in the yard with his grandsons, Parker’s presence lit up every room he was in.
He found peace and joy in the outdoors, often retreating to nature for solitude and reflection. The Natchez Trace held a special place in his heart, serving as the backdrop for many of his favorite walks and quiet moments.
His very favorite past time was visiting the casino with his wife, Tonya. Gambling was a dear hobby of his. Though he had a mischievous streak, Parker’s kindness ran deep. He loved fiercely and freely, and those lucky enough to know him will remember him not only for his laughter and light-hearted jokes but also for his generosity, warmth, and loyalty.
He was a long time employee of Confortaire, working there as the General Manager for over 25 years.
Simply put, he was one of the best people you could ever meet. He leaves behind a legacy of love, laughter, and unforgettable memories. He will be deeply missed by all who had the pleasure of knowing him.
